11. For the reversible reaction , A (s) + B (g) = C (g) + D (g) , Change in gibbs free energy is -350 kJ, Which of the following statement is true? *
2 points
The reaction is thermodynamically non-feasible
The entropy Change is negative
Equilibrium Constant is greater than one
The reaction should be instantaneous

In the reversible reaction,
Since, the randomness increases (because solid is changing into gas), entropy will increase and thus, is positive. Reversible reaction never undergo to completion.
K (equilibrium constant) is greater than one.
And ,the reaction is thermodynamically feasible.
So, the answer is Option C) Equilibrium constant is greater than one
